From 9726a83bde95b436e9c770aade727b791840ebfc Mon Sep 17 00:00:00 2001 From: Shadowghost Date: Wed, 12 Oct 2022 22:30:40 +0200 Subject: [PATCH] Properly check for NaN instead of undefined --- src/routes/user/userparentalcontrol.tsx |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/routes/user/userparentalcontrol.tsx b/src/routes/user/userparentalcontrol.tsx index 4fe1305cf9..2fe717a9fc 100644 --- a/src/routes/user/userparentalcontrol.tsx +++ b/src/routes/user/userparentalcontrol.tsx @@ -224,7 +224,7 @@ const UserParentalControl: FunctionComponent = () => { } const parentalRating = parseInt((page.querySelector('#selectMaxParentalRating') as HTMLSelectElement).value || '0', 10); - user.Policy.MaxParentalRating = parentalRating !== undefined ? parentalRating : null; + user.Policy.MaxParentalRating = Number.isNaN(parentalRating) ? null : parentalRating; user.Policy.BlockUnratedItems = Array.prototype.filter.call(page.querySelectorAll('.chkUnratedItem'), function (i) { return i.checked; }).map(function (i) {